Imagick::extentImage

(PECL imagick 2, PECL imagick 3)

Imagick::extentImageDefine tamanho da imagem

Descrição

public Imagick::extentImage(
    int $width,
    int $height,
    int $x,
    int $y
): bool

Método de conforto para definir o tamanho da imagem. O método define o tamanho da imagem e permite definir as coordenadas x,y onde começa a nova área. Este método estará disponível se a extensão Imagick tiver sido compilada com a ImageMagick versão 6.3.1 ou superior.

Caution

Antes do ImageMagick 6.5.7-8 (1623), $x era positivo ao deslocar para a esquerda e negativo ao deslocar para a direita, e $y era positivo ao deslocar uma imagem para cima e negativo ao deslocar uma imagem para baixo. Em algum momento entre o ImageMagick 6.3.7 (1591) e o ImageMagick 6.5.7-8 (1623), os eixos de $x e $y foram invertidos, de modo que $x fosse negativo ao deslocar para a esquerda e positivo ao deslocar para a direita, e $y foi negativo ao deslocar uma imagem para cima e positivo ao deslocar uma imagem para baixo. Em algum momento entre o ImageMagick 6.5.7-8 (1623) e o ImageMagick 6.6.9-7 (1641), os eixos de $x e $y foram revertidos para a funcionalidade pré-ImageMagick 6.5.7-8 (1623).

Parâmetros

width

A nova largura

height

A nova altura

x

Posição X para o novo tamanho

y

Posição Y para o novo tamanho

Valor Retornado

Retorna true em caso de sucesso.

Veja Também